WebMay 2, 2024 · The Importance of Currencies May 2nd, 2024 Don Rich Currencies are an important consideration in investments. First, exchange rates directly affect the investment returns for all non-U.S. investments. Second, the currency markets can provide insights on risk appetite and portfolio flows.
